Item 5: Fees and Compensation
Investment Management Services
Our standard advisory fee is based on the market value of the assets under management of the client’s accounts
with the firm and is calculated as follows:
Account Value Annual Advisory Fee
$0 - $500,000 .60%
$500,000 and Above .50%
The annual fees are negotiable, pro-rated and paid in arrears on a quarterly basis. The advisory fee is a tiered fee
and is calculated by assessing the percentage rates using the predefined levels of assets as shown in the above chart
and applying the fee to the account value as of the last day of the previous quarter. No increase in the annual fee
shall be effective without agreement from the client by signing a new agreement or amendment to their current
advisory agreement.
Advisory fees are directly debited from client accounts, or the client may choose to pay by check. Accounts
initiated or terminated during a calendar quarter will be charged a pro-rated fee based on the amount of time
remaining in the billing period. An account may be terminated with written notice at least 30 calendar days in
advance. Since fees are paid in arrears, no refund will be needed upon termination of the account.
Other Types of Fees and Expenses
Our fees are exclusive of brokerage commissions, transaction fees, and other related costs and expenses which
may be incurred by the client. Clients may incur certain charges imposed by custodians, brokers, and other third
parties such as custodial fees, deferred sales charges, odd-lot differentials, transfer taxes, wire transfer, and
electronic fund fees, and other fees and taxes on brokerage accounts and securities transactions. Mutual fund and
exchange-traded funds also charge internal management fees, which are disclosed in a fund's prospectus. Such
charges, fees, and commissions are exclusive of and in addition to our fee, and we shall not receive any portion of
these commissions, fees, and costs.
Item 12 further describes the factors that we consider in selecting or recommending broker-dealers for client’s
transactions and determining the reasonableness of their compensation (e.g., commissions).
We do not accept compensation for the sale of securities or other investment products including asset-based sales
charges or service fees from the sale of mutual funds. |

Item 7: Types of Clients We provide portfolio management services to individuals, high net-worth individuals, pension and profit sharing plans, charitable organizations, corporations or other businesses. We do not have a minimum account size requirement. |
